  1. Loudness and Dynamic Range: Optimizing the loudness and dynamic range of the mixed audio for playback on various platforms.
  2. EQ and Compression: Making final adjustments to the tone and dynamics of the mixed audio.
  3. Stereo Imaging: Enhancing the stereo image of the mixed audio to create a wider and more immersive soundstage.
  4. Multiband Compression: Using multiband compression to control the dynamic range of different frequency ranges.
